Some querries cannot be 'unstarred'
Closed, ResolvedPublic

Description

Originally reported on :mw:Talk:Quarry.

Bulgu said:

I was trying to organize the favorite queries by their url (newer queries have bigger numbers in the url). I noticed that when I unstar and then star several queries, they do not effectively get unstarred; multiple copies start to exist. Please check https://quarry.wmflabs.org/query/11613 and https://quarry.wmflabs.org/query/11685 .

Check his Quarry profile and you will see the query:11685 appearing around 6 times in the list of starred querries.

Mentioned in SAL (#wikimedia-cloud) [2017-12-10T05:49:30Z] <zhuyifei1999_> quarry-main-01: ALTER IGNORE TABLE star ADD UNIQUE INDEX star_user_query_index (user_id, query_id); Records: 728 Duplicates: 17 Warnings: 0 T165169
